git的相關操作
初次使用 需要 填寫使用者名稱與郵箱
建立分支
git branch name
切換到當前分支
git checkout name
合併分支
git merge name
合併之後 可以刪除分支了
git branch -d name
有緊急bug修復 需要先停下來 切換到master 目錄下 新建分支 修復bug
多個人同時修改檔案的同一地方 會產生衝突
解決方法 找到 出錯檔案的地方 協商修改的最終版本 最後由乙個人 去提交解決問題
首次登入
需要配置使用者名稱 和郵箱
git config --global user.name "your name"
git config --global user.email "郵箱"
建立倉庫mkdir progrect//建立資料夾
cd progrect
pwd
#####git init建立倉庫
git init
initialized empty git repository in e:/gitspace/.git/
裡面有乙個隱藏的git資料夾
ls -ah 就可以看到了
$ git config --global core.autocrlf false //禁用自動轉換
$ git init
$ git add readme.txt
$ git commit -m"add readme file"[master (root-commit) f4625e1] add readme file1 file changed, 2 insertions(+)
create mode 100644 readme.txt
提交多個檔案
git add .
檢視檔案修改的地方
git status
檢視修改的詳細地方
git diff
####畫重點 這些命令都是在 git bash 裡面進行使用的
git專案的同步 實操
首次登入 需要
git config --global user.name "your name"
git config --global user.email "郵箱"
在本地生成 公私
使用滑鼠右鍵 開啟git bash here 進行輸入下面的命令
已經生成過了 就不需要在生成公鑰
ssh-keygen -t rsa -c "***xx@***xx.com" 生成公鑰
cat ~/.ssh/id_rsa.pub 檢視公鑰
將公私 進行複製
在設定裡面 將公私進行貼上進去
就可以了 本地有乙個私鑰可以和線上進行匹配 這樣就實現了 線上和線下的連線
轉殖線上**
git clone [email protected]:shangguanjm/trval.git
[email protected]:shangguanjm/trval.git這一段是線上轉殖的
這樣就可以轉殖**到線下了
這個是將全部檔案進行轉殖下來
上傳本地**
git status 檢視檔案的狀態
git add . 將檔案放到暫存區
git commit -m 'project initialized' (提交到本地倉庫 引號的內容可以自定義,用於描述提交資訊)
git push 提交 上去
獲取分支
git fetch
切換到遠端master分支:
git checkout origin/master
github具體的操作
其實你只要切換到trval 裡面進去
記住不要自己多新增資料夾了
分支的操作 進行寫**
在碼雲裡面建立專案的分支
起點就是預設分支 master 分支的名稱swiper
建立分支之後
在本地執行 git pull 同步線上的分支
切換到分支的目錄
git checkout swiper
git status 檢視本地的分支或者狀態 然後開發的東西都在這個分支裡面進行了
#####分支**寫完了
git add .
git commit -m 『change』
git push
切換到master分支
git checkout master
git merge 『swiper』 合併分支
git push 在將master的內容同步到分支上面
分支上進行開發功能 實現多人合作開發
以上就是開發者使用 git和碼雲的流程
git 相關命令
簡單用法 git cherry pick git如何進行分支管理?1 建立分支 建立分支很簡單 git branch 分支名 2 切換分支 git checkout 分支名 該語句和上乙個語句可以和起來用乙個語句表示 git checkout b 分支名 3 分支合併 比如,如果要將開發中的分支 d...
git相關命令
1.根據已有分支建立新分支dev git checkout b dev 2.檢視當前分支 git branch 3.提交該分支到遠端倉庫 git push origin dev 4.從遠端分支獲取dev git pull origin dev 5.為本地分支設定預設提交獲取分支 git branch...
git相關命令
git 1 遠端倉庫相關命令 檢出倉庫 git clone git 檢視遠端倉庫 git remote v 新增遠端倉庫 git remote add name url 刪除遠端倉庫 git remote rm name 修改遠端倉庫 git remote set url push name new...